The song draws significant inspiration from fairy tale Kelionė į Tandadriką ( Journey to Tandadrika ).

This is mirrored in the song's ending chant—"Bitė atskris" ("The bee will fly in")—symbolizing hope and the rebirth of life . Musicality-wise, this "bee" is represented by a cello arrangement that mimics the buzzing and movement of the insect. Visual Representation
